Transaction e24d6b2fb2a12e25645c79278b323fa2f2900ee270b9a8f0d1060c080d09b3e4
1 Input
1 Output
-
e24d6b2fb2a12e25645c79278b323fa2f2900ee270b9a8f0d1060c080d09b3e4:0
- value
- 157683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ed5c7e21befa505b702b2ec39e445163c87d31c5 OP_EQUAL
- address
- 3PL4sWidYV9dkQdNCB8z5rYuiGE668FykN